Is it "fast enough?": Two Undergraduate Students' Guided Reinvention of the Comparison Test

Series convergence is a key part of the calculus curriculum; however, there is limited research on ways to support students conjecturing about series convergence. We conducted a teaching experiment using Realistic Mathematics Education in which we supported two undergraduate calculus students in reinventing statements about series convergence. We present the students’ reinvention of the comparison test and how it was related to their informal ideas about the sequences n^-1 and n^-2. Our study is an existence proof showing that students can be supported to conjecture tests for series convergence.
